WAGON TRAIN LAKE STATE RECREATION AREA HABITAT IMPROVEMENT PROJECT

Local Conservation in Action

 

The Big Game Conservation Association – Lincoln Branch set out to complete a project close to home. In the spring of 2018, members began working with a Nebraska Game & Parks Commission biologist responsible for Wagon Train Lake State Recreation Area.

​

The primary objective was to establish a sustainable food source to benefit deer and other wildlife species utilizing the area.

PROJECT IMPLEMANTATION

After identifying a suitable location, approximately 2.5 acres were selected for habitat improvement.

 

• The area was shredded to prepare the site
• Vegetation was treated to control unwanted weeds and grasses
• A brassicas forage mix was planted

​

This blend was selected specifically to provide a valuable food source extending late into the winter months — a critical period for wildlife survival.
